A parallel beam of monochromatic light of wavelength 489 nm passes through a single slit of width 0.3 mm. The angular width of the central maxima is

  1. A \( 1.63 \times 10^{-6} \, rad \)
  2. B \( 6.13 \times 10^2 \, rad \)
  3. C \( 1.63 \times 10^{-3} \, rad \)
  4. D \( 3.26 \times 10^{-3} \, rad \)

Correct Answer

(D) \( 3.26 \times 10^{-3} \, rad \)

Angular width \( = 2 \frac{\lambda}{a} \) \( = 2 \frac{489 \times 10^{-9} \text{ m}}{0.3 \times 10^{-3} \text{ m}} \) \( = 3.26 \times 10^{-3} \text{ rad} \)
